Your Santa Barbara County Board of Supervisors, in a truly breathtaking display of bureaucratic foresight, has decided to consider the 'Road Maintenance Annual Plan' for Fiscal Year 2026-2027. Yes, you read that right. While your tires are presently sacrificing themselves to local moonscapes, our county overlords are busy penciling in asphalt repairs for a time when, frankly, most of us will be driving hovercrafts or, more likely, horse-drawn buggies to navigate the debris.

This isn't just about fixing a few cracks; this is about a full-on, multi-year strategic vision to ensure our roads are adequately, perhaps even *critically*, decayed before any actual work commences. The agenda item from the SB County Board of Supervisors helpfully notes the plan will authorize the Director of Public Works to 'advertise for construction.' So, after two years of planning the planning, we can expect two more years of consultants consulting on the construction bids. Meanwhile, our county roads will continue their valiant effort to cosplay as the lunar surface.

But fear not, taxpayers! The best part is that this exquisite piece of governmental 'efficiency' is deemed exempt from CEQA. That's right, mending a few million potholes and paving over what remains of our infrastructure is a 'minor alteration' with 'negligible or no expansion of use.' One might posit that maintaining a functional road network at all is an 'expansion of use' when compared to driving on what currently resembles a forgotten WWI battlefield. But why quibble over such trivialities when the county can pat itself on the back for planning so far ahead, even if the 'ahead' is well past the point of all common-sense utility? Truly, a masterclass in making the simple impossibly complex, then applauding the effort.
